diff for duplicates of <20201218184347.2180772-14-sam@ravnborg.org>
diff --git a/a/1.txt b/N1/1.txt
index cc107e0..0e84c73 100644
--- a/a/1.txt
+++ b/N1/1.txt
@@ -178,17 +178,14 @@ index 4ebf51e6e78e..c846acdb4455 100644
@@ -358,7 +358,7 @@ static struct platform_device * __init scan_one_device(struct device_node *dp,
op->archdata.num_irqs = len / sizeof(struct linux_prom_irqs);
for (i = 0; i < op->archdata.num_irqs; i++)
- op->archdata.irqs[i] =
-- sparc_config.build_device_irq(op, intr[i].pri);
+ op->archdata.irqs[i] - sparc_config.build_device_irq(op, intr[i].pri);
+ leon_build_device_irq(intr[i].pri, handle_simple_irq, "edge", 0);
} else {
- const unsigned int *irq =
- of_get_property(dp, "interrupts", &len);
+ const unsigned int *irq of_get_property(dp, "interrupts", &len);
@@ -367,7 +367,7 @@ static struct platform_device * __init scan_one_device(struct device_node *dp,
op->archdata.num_irqs = len / sizeof(unsigned int);
for (i = 0; i < op->archdata.num_irqs; i++)
- op->archdata.irqs[i] =
-- sparc_config.build_device_irq(op, irq[i]);
+ op->archdata.irqs[i] - sparc_config.build_device_irq(op, irq[i]);
+ leon_build_device_irq(irq[i], handle_simple_irq, "edge", 0);
} else {
op->archdata.num_irqs = 0;
diff --git a/a/content_digest b/N1/content_digest
index 27fff7a..1591ee3 100644
--- a/a/content_digest
+++ b/N1/content_digest
@@ -8,7 +8,7 @@
"Subject\0[PATCH v1 13/13] sparc32: drop use of sparc_config\0"
]
[
- "Date\0Fri, 18 Dec 2020 19:43:47 +0100\0"
+ "Date\0Fri, 18 Dec 2020 18:43:47 +0000\0"
]
[
"To\0David S Miller <davem\@davemloft.net>",
@@ -229,17 +229,14 @@
"\@\@ -358,7 +358,7 \@\@ static struct platform_device * __init scan_one_device(struct device_node *dp,\n",
" \t\top->archdata.num_irqs = len / sizeof(struct linux_prom_irqs);\n",
" \t\tfor (i = 0; i < op->archdata.num_irqs; i++)\n",
- " \t\t\top->archdata.irqs[i] =\n",
- "-\t\t\t sparc_config.build_device_irq(op, intr[i].pri);\n",
+ " \t\t\top->archdata.irqs[i] -\t\t\t sparc_config.build_device_irq(op, intr[i].pri);\n",
"+\t\t\t leon_build_device_irq(intr[i].pri, handle_simple_irq, \"edge\", 0);\n",
" \t} else {\n",
- " \t\tconst unsigned int *irq =\n",
- " \t\t\tof_get_property(dp, \"interrupts\", &len);\n",
+ " \t\tconst unsigned int *irq \t\t\tof_get_property(dp, \"interrupts\", &len);\n",
"\@\@ -367,7 +367,7 \@\@ static struct platform_device * __init scan_one_device(struct device_node *dp,\n",
" \t\t\top->archdata.num_irqs = len / sizeof(unsigned int);\n",
" \t\t\tfor (i = 0; i < op->archdata.num_irqs; i++)\n",
- " \t\t\t\top->archdata.irqs[i] =\n",
- "-\t\t\t\t sparc_config.build_device_irq(op, irq[i]);\n",
+ " \t\t\t\top->archdata.irqs[i] -\t\t\t\t sparc_config.build_device_irq(op, irq[i]);\n",
"+\t\t\t\t leon_build_device_irq(irq[i], handle_simple_irq, \"edge\", 0);\n",
" \t\t} else {\n",
" \t\t\top->archdata.num_irqs = 0;\n",
@@ -459,4 +456,4 @@
"2.27.0"
]
-a491799df3a7a45f36ff0809c7d09b370ad79388f140a04f5bce3502231b822a
+11df5caafd29743cfc02b9b08d4f9e69a4d8595ca3c09da29e63c22ef63b01aa
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.